An electron of mass 9.11x10^-31 kg has an initial speed of 3.00x10^5 m/s. It travels in a straight line, and its speed increases to 7.00x10^5 m/s in a distance of 5.00cm. Assuming its acceleration is constant:
Part a
Determine the magnitude of the force exerted on the electron.
Part b
Compare this force with the weight of the electron, which we ignored.
